Search Results for 172.64.155.40

Showing security analysis results for IP address: 172.64.155.40

Search Results(4 results)

URLStatusSubmittedTitleASN
https://data.worldbank.org.cncompleted2 months agoWorld Bank Open Data | Data-
https://clevelandcliniclondon.ukcompleted6 months agoCleveland Clinic London-
https://health.clevelandclinic.org/living-healthy/mens-healthcompleted7 months agohealth.clevelandclinic.org-
https://my.clevelandclinic.org/health/drugs/4086-depo-provera-birth-control-shotcompleted9 months agoDepo-Provera® (Birth Control Shot): Risks & Benefits-